Atkore, Inc is a manufacturer of electrical raceway. It is divided into two segments: Electrical and Safety and Infrastructure. The Electrical segment manufactures products for the construction of electrical systems, such as cable, conduit, and installation equipment. Safety and Infrastructure designs and develops solutions such as metal framing and mechanical pipe for critical infrastructure protection and reliability.
